How to Repair Key Fob Issues
Despite their durability key fobs aren't immune to wear and tear. They can get worn out or cease to function. This can happen for a variety of reasons.
The most common reason is a dead or dying battery. Changing the battery is an easy solution. Other problems could be more complex. Signal interference is one possible cause. It could also be a problem with a button.
Battery
Your key fob is a pretty small and fragile piece of plastic, which is why it's not hard for things to go wrong. Most key fob problems aren't a big deal or even serious, and can be fixed with the right tools and a basic understanding. In some cases it could be as simple as changing batteries.
You should first check your key fob to see whether there are any indications of damage. The exterior of your key fob ought to be free of dents, scratches and other signs that indicate the battery is depleted or that the fob isn't functioning properly. After you've checked the exterior, you'll want to use a flat-head screwdriver to break open the key fob's shell and look at the battery and circuit board. Most key fobs are powered by an a 3V button cell, which is readily available in stores like Walmart. Consult your owner's guide or an auto Locksmith if you are unsure of the type of battery your key fob requires.
If your key fob isn't working after you've replaced the batteries it could be because of interference. This can occur when other devices or security systems interfere with radio signals transmitted between your key fob and your vehicle. Buttons
Key fobs are useful additions to modern vehicles, but they can also be a source of trouble. A few simple troubleshooting techniques and maintenance tips will ensure that your key fobs always function as you expect them to.
One of the main reasons a car key fob stops working is a dead battery. A typical key fob can last between three and four years. If you notice that it takes more than one click to unlock your vehicle or that your car is not as responsive as before, it may be time to replace the batteries.
Most people can replace the battery on a key fob by themselves. Most key fobs feature an indentation of a small size that you can press using the flathead screwdriver or coin to unlock the case, allowing you to take out the battery and then insert the new one. The majority of key fobs are powered by a lithium-ion button cell, which is readily accessible at all places that sell batteries, including supermarkets, home improvement stores and pharmacies.
A key fob that stops working could be due to the buttons aren't functioning properly. Some key fobs come with an unlock button that closes the doors to the vehicle. Others come with an unlock button that allows you to unlock the doors and open or close the trunk with the second push. If pressing the lock or unlock buttons on your key fob does nothing, it could indicate a problem with the wiring, switch or antenna. Check the manual for your vehicle for more details.
The final common problem with a key fob is that it's not transmitting the correct signals to the vehicle. This could happen if the key fob is damaged, or if it's subjected to electromagnetic interference, which could be from devices in your pocket as well as other electronic devices or even from your vehicle's security system itself. Case Study
Key fobs can be a fantastic convenience for car owners. However, they can have problems that need to be fixed. Certain issues can be solved by replacing the battery. Other issues may require more work. There are a few ways to prevent problems with your fob from happening in the first instance. Cleaning the fob on a regular basis is important, as are using the correct batteries and keeping it out of magnetic fields and other electromagnetic fields.
A dead battery is one of the most common reasons for a key fob to cease to function. The replacement of the battery is an simple procedure that can be accomplished at home. The majority of key fobs have an indentation on the back which you can use an open-ended screwdriver to remove and replace the old battery with a new one. Use the exact type of battery that is recommended by your owner's manual. If you use the wrong battery can corrode the electronics inside of the fob, causing it to stop functioning properly.
Signal interference is another common issue that can cause the key fob to stop functioning. Signal interference can be caused when electronic devices or security systems interfere with your keyfob and the control unit of your vehicle. Test this by unlocking your vehicle with a spare fob.
A key fob's case can also become damaged, which can cause it to stop functioning properly. Fortunately, this is another issue that is usually repaired by an experienced locksmith. They can fix the outer case, and make sure that all of the internal components are in good working order. This can be more cost effective than buying an entirely new fob.
